Analysis of the Production Planning and Inventory Control System used by NADEP (Naval Aviation Depot)

Abstract

This thesis is an analysis of the current production planning and inventory control system used by NADEP, North Island for the repair of the T-64 series engine. The system is described and analyzed for its effect on repair time and work-in-process inventory. Recommendations are made to improve repair time and reduce work-in-process inventory levels. A simulation and queueing theory are used to compare the queue of awaiting maintenance engines under the current system versus the queue when a specified monthly repair rate is maintained.
